Bitcoin on December 25, 2011: context
On December 25, 2011, one Bitcoin cost $4.63. A $1,000 investment would have purchased 215.982721BTC. At today's price of $66,926, that holding would be worth $14.45M — a 1445.4k%return. This calculation does not account for transaction fees, taxes, or the emotional difficulty of holding through Bitcoin's famous volatility. Past performance does not guarantee future results.
